Output bbf37b5330ccf868fd0fcd7a605d33d034bf9ba309bf2fc4d83cdc3ea0fb0366:0

value
133155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ddff58cb1bb3d54e0de508afc940fe6ffae464cf OP_EQUAL
address
3Mvq9kMr4vRz6FEJeh4xZGBBn5ranWMoXL
transaction
bbf37b5330ccf868fd0fcd7a605d33d034bf9ba309bf2fc4d83cdc3ea0fb0366
confirmations
267341
spent
true